HISTORICAL SOCIETY TO HOST LECTURE
The Henderson Historical Society is slated to host its next Henderson Speaks lecture at 6:30 p.m. Oct. 11 at the College of Southern Nevada Henderson campus, 700 College Drive.
The event is expected to feature Richard Bryan, a former Nevada governor and U.S. senator, and Guy Rocha, Nevada State College’s associate professor of history.
Labor and race relations at the Basic Magnesium Plant and the impact industrial plants had on Henderson’s economy are expected to be discussed.
The event is free and open to the public.

HENDERSON COMPANY WINS AWARD FOR VIDEO PRODUCTION
Henderson-based company Trosper Communications LLC received the Award of Distinction in the web-based production category of the 2013 Videographer Awards.
The business won the award for its video on the history of the Professional Fire Fighters of Nevada.

BUSINESS EXPO SCHEDULED
The fourth annual Henderson Business Connection & Expo is scheduled at 10 a.m. Oct. 18 at the Valley Freeway Commerce Center, 7585 Commercial Way.
The free event is slated to include 70 booths for business-to-business networking and panels on topics such as health care law and economic development.
